§ 157.042 ZONING DISTRICT MAP.
   (A)   The boundaries of the districts as established by this chapter are as shown on the map published herewith and made part of this chapter, said map is designated as the official zoning map of the city and shall be maintained as provided herein by the City Zoning Administrator. The district boundary lines on said map are intended to follow street right-of-way lines, street centerlines or lot lines unless such boundary line is otherwise indicated on the map. In the case of unsubdivided property or in any case where street or lot lines are not used as boundaries, the district boundary lines shall be determined by use of dimensions or the scale appearing on the map. All of the notations, references and other information shown thereon shall have the same force and effect as if fully set forth herein and are hereby made a part of this chapter by reference and incorporated herein as fully as if set forth herein at length, whenever any street or other public way is vacated, any zoning district line following the centerline of said vacated street or way shall not be affected by such vacation.
   (B)   When any permit is issued for a planned unit development or any other permit which affects any zoning district in a substantial way, said permit shall be coded and noted on the zoning district map by the Zoning Administrator so as to clearly indicate the use so permitted which may not otherwise be clearly evident from the map or text of this chapter.
   (C)   When uses in a district are listed as both permitted and as conditional uses, or when any other conflict appears in this chapter with respect to permitted uses within a district, the more restrictive portion shall be applied.
